Pan-Baltic Gencs Valters Law Firm, with offices in Latvia, Lithuania and Estonia, held together with their partners from USA seminar How to do Business in the United States of America. Seminar has been held 19 September 2012 in Radisson Blu Ridzene Hotel, Riga.
Representatives of Frost Brown Todd LLC from Cincinnati, Ohio presented their views on entrepreneurship relations between US and Latvia. Attorney Joseph Dehner spoke about possibilities for Latvian companies to enter the highly-competitive US market via strategic alliances and attorney Susan Grogan Faller spoke about costs of litigation in US. Two lawyers practicing law for more than 70 years combined provided valuable information about every day reality of business in US.

The joint Nordic-Baltic Mobility Programme for Business and Industry promote economic cooperation, innovation and entrepreneurship to strengthen the global competitive power of the Nordic-Baltic region. The Programme gives financial support to SMEs, business incubators and organizations in the fields of business and industry to carry out study visits, internships, training or network activities.

RIGA, Feb 23 (LETA) - Saeima today passed in the final reading amendments to the Administrative Violations Code, introducing fines for violations in residents' declarations of their property status.
The amendments stipulate that fines of up to LVL 250 will apply to residents who fail to submit their property status declarations, fill out the declarations incorrectly or fail to declare part of their properties or savings.

VILNIUS, Feb 8 (LETA) - NATO has extended the alliance's patrol of Baltic airspace until 2018, Lithuanian Radio reported on Wednesday. The current mandate of the patrol mission is in force until the end of 2014.
NATO Secretary General Anders Fogh Rasmussen is satisfied with the decision made by the alliance.
''This mission confirms the alliance's commitment towards collective defense and solidarity,'' Rasmussen emphasized.

RIGA, Jan 31 (LETA) - The government today approved the Finance Ministry's procedure for the declaration of cash savings by private individuals, whereby person who have such cash savings will have to transfer them to their accounts in commercial banks.
The regulations stipulate that this will have to be done by 12 midnight on June 1 this year.
The law on private individuals' declarations of financial circumstances, which came into force December 15 last year, stipulates that residents will have to declare cash savings worth more than LVL 10,000, in lats or foreign currencies, which they will have to pay into their bank accounts. For officials, the minimum limit is LVL 4,000.
